Using detergent and water to clean oil is a physical change because it does not alter the chemical composition of the oil. The oil is simply being physically separated and removed from the surface it was on, but it remains the same substance chemically.
Gold is measures in 24ths. 10k gold is 10 parts gold to 14 parts "filler". 14k gold is 14 parts gold to 10 parts "filler". 18k gold is 18 parts gold to 6 parts "filler". 24k gold is all gold. (Impurities will exist.) The filler is usually nickel in North America (which is why those with nickel allergies have trouble wearing gold of lower quality than about 18k). In Europe, silver is often used as the filler. Other fillers can be zinc, lead, or anything else. I'm not aware of anyone using stainless steel as the filler material.

To replace a shower nozzle, first turn off the water supply. Then, unscrew the old nozzle using a wrench or pliers. Clean the area and apply plumber's tape to the threads of the new nozzle. Screw on the new nozzle tightly and turn the water supply back on to test for leaks.

The best way to clean outdoor surfaces effectively using a pressure washer spray nozzle is to start by selecting the appropriate nozzle for the job, such as a 25-degree nozzle for general cleaning. Then, adjust the pressure to a suitable level for the surface being cleaned. Begin by spraying from a distance to avoid damage, and work in sections, moving the nozzle in a consistent back-and-forth motion. Finally, rinse the surface thoroughly to remove any dirt or debris.

To control spatter on the nozzle during overhead welding, maintain a proper welding technique by adjusting the travel speed and angle of the torch. Utilizing the correct voltage and amperage settings for the material can also minimize excessive spatter. Additionally, using anti-spatter spray on the nozzle and work area can help prevent spatter buildup, ensuring a cleaner weld and easier cleanup. Regularly cleaning the nozzle and using appropriate filler materials will further enhance spatter control.
